摘 要:针对某铜硫矿山的铜尾矿的大量23μm以下细粒级硫损失的情况,应用BGRIMM细粒浮选成套技术装备开展了规模为1.0~1.5 t/h的细粒级硫浮选回收的扩大试验研究。试验结果表明:在入选硫品位为8.25%时,通过两粗一扫两精的浮选工艺流程,产出的硫精矿含硫45.40%,硫作业回收率达到了85.30%,精矿以细粒硫矿物为主,实现了对细粒级硫的有效回收。In view of the large amount of fine particle sulfur loss below 23μm in copper tailings of a Cu-S mine,the scale-up continuous experimental research on the flotation recovering of fine particle sulfur with the scale of 1.0-1.5 t/h is carried out by applying the fine flotation equipment of BGRIMM.The test results show that while the content of sulfur in raw ore is 8.25%,the sulfur concentrate produced by the flotation process of two roughing,one scavenging and two cleaning can contain 45.40%of sulfur,and the sulfur recovery reaches 85.30%.The concentrate is dominated by fine sulfur minerals,realizing the effective recovery of fine sulfur.
